Yonge is a surname. Notable people with the surname include:

  • Charles Duke Yonge (1812–1891), English historian and translator of Philo of Alexandria
  • Charles Maurice Yonge (1899–1986), British marine biologist
  • Charlotte Mary Yonge (1823–1901), English author
  • Sir George Yonge, 5th Baronet (1731–1812), British Secretary at War and the namesake of Yonge Street
  • Jane Yonge, New Zealand theatre director
  • John Yonge (1465–1516), English bishop and diplomat
  • Sir John Yonge, 1st Baronet (1603–1663), English merchant and Member of Parliament
  • Nicholas Yonge (1560–1619), English Renaissance singer and publisher
  • Roby Yonge (1943–1997), American radio DJ
  • Thomas Yonge or Young (1405–1476), MP for Bristol and Gloustershire, justice of the Common Pleas and the King's Bench
  • Walter Yonge of Colyton (1579–1649), English lawyer, merchant and Member of Parliament
  • Sir Walter Yonge, 2nd Baronet (1625–1670)
  • Sir Walter Yonge, 3rd Baronet (1653–1731)
